Binary package hint: gnome-disk-utility

In palimpsest, when creating a new partition, selecting "Empty" as the
partition type causes the window to be much too small for the slider to
be useful. This is because of the default, smallest-possible sizing of
the window. However, making the window resizable isn't really enough as
I'd have to make it bigger every time I use it. I'd suggest a reasonable
minimum size be set that allows the slider to always be functional even
if labels are smaller.
